**Action item PM-442: Audit-log viewer pagination**

During the Varrick incident review, the viewer at Holloway Systems timed out when analysts paged past 50k entries, delaying triage by two hours. Fix: cursor-based pagination with capped fetch windows, owned by the Ledgerline team, due end of sprint 31. Security review required before the cap values ship, since they bound how much log history one query can pull. The agreed tuning constants are as follows.

tuning table, kajog-kawef:
PRIORITIES = {
    "kelox": 870,
    "kasix": 89,
    "eliax": 988,
}

If intermittent NXDOMAIN errors exceed 2% over 10 minutes, escalate immediately. Do not restart the resolver pods; capture packet traces first. Check whether failures correlate with the Harrowfield edge zone — poisoning attempts have been observed there before. Verify DNSSEC validation logs are intact and export them to the sealed audit bucket. If validation failures appear alongside resolution flaps, treat as a potential security incident and escalate past on-call. Send the trace bundle and a one-line summary to the resolver security desk.

billing contact of hahig-yajop = fraael_fraox@nelvrocorp.internal

## Changelog — Bouncewright 4.2.0

Defaults changed for the bounce processor. Hard bounces now suppress a recipient after one event instead of three, and soft-bounce retry backoff doubled to reduce reputation damage with strict receivers. The quarantine sweep also runs hourly rather than daily. These defaults apply to all new deployments automatically; existing installs must opt in. On upgrade, confirm the processor starts with these configuration values.

config for kafof-bawef:
holath:
  log_level: debug
  metrics_host: metrics.holath.qorvelsys.internal
  pin: 2191
  pool_size: 32

Welcome aboard! Quick primer before your first steering call. Kestrelmark has been courting Bluehollow Analytics for about six months on a joint venture to co-develop the Larkspur data platform for the Veridale market. Legal framework is roughed out, equity split still contentious (we want 55/45, they want parity). Marta Quillen has the negotiation history if you need color. Revenue modelling looks promising but hinges on their channel partners. The sensitive part of the plan is summarized below.

board note of kafog-bajep: Briathek Partners is in early talks to buy Aldaelek Group for about $47.1 million. The Ulaath launch date is September 4, and nothing goes to the press before then.